About the role

  • The IT Technical Services Lead is the primary "on-the-ground" owner of all technology for our 55-person facility. Reporting to the Director of IT, you are the face of IT for our staff. You don’t need to be an expert in every single technology, but you must be a master of follow-through.


Key Accountabilities

  • Primary Hands-On Support: Serve as the first point of contact for all IT issues. Accountable for regular technical support in our facilities, including but not limited to computers, laser printers, Zebra printers, video conferencing, and WiFi connection
  • Vendor Management: Manage relationships with third-party providers (Networking, Security, Dev). You are responsible for escalating issues to these experts, managing their timelines, and holding them accountable for results.
  • Network & Security Operations: Manage the Ubiquiti (Unifi/UDM Pro) and Todyl environment. You should understand networking fundamentals (IPs, VLANs, connectivity) and work with our partners to ensure Network Availability.
  • Incident Ownership & Root Cause: When systems fail, you own the issue from ticket creation to final resolution. You are responsible for identifying the root cause and implementing remedies to prevent recurrence.
  • Lifecycle & Onboarding: Lead onsite new hire onboarding (device setup, account access readiness, office setup), ensuring a consistent RBW experience from day one by managing the "physical" side of the People Team partnership—provisioning hardware via Rippling MDM, setting up Google Workspace,.
  • Documentation: Use Notion to document vendor contact workflows, local hardware maps, and troubleshooting guides so that no knowledge is "siloed..
  • Facility Tech Maintenance: Physical upkeep of Kisi Access Control, Google Meet conference rooms, and shop-floor production terminals (Yield MES).


Technical "Generalist" Skills

  • Networking: Comfortable navigating Ubiquiti Network Infrastructure. You don't need to be a network architect, but you must be able to troubleshoot a dropped connection or a faulty switch port.
  • Security: Familiarity with Todyl and Rippling MDM to ensure all 55 endpoints stay compliant and patched.
  • Business Systems: General ability to support users in NetSuite (ERP).
  • Collaboration Tools: Daily administration of G-Suite, Google Voice, Wrike, and Zendesk.


Qualifications & Traits

  • The "Owner" Mindset: You take it personally when things aren't working. You don't "pass the buck" to a vendor; you pull the vendor across the finish line.
  • 5+ Years in IT Support: Experience in a Lead or Senior Help Desk role, ideally in a manufacturing environment.
  • Project Management: Ability to manage multiple vendors and internal stakeholders simultaneously without losing track of the details.
  • Communication: Confident in dealing with factory floor staff, the Director of IT, and high-level external consultants.
  • Technical Intuition: You have a "knack" for technology that allows you to pick up new SaaS tools and hardware quickly.

Compensation


The pay range for this role is:

72,227 - 89,321 USD per year (Kingston NY - Factory)
